It's Hard



It's hard to find a smile from within,
Pretending ignorance to the world around.
Counting down the seconds,minutes,then the hours,
Waiting for reality to stop,but it never ends.

It's hard to wake up like this all alone,
Fooling myself that you're right here beside me.
Tears streaming down my face,I open my eyes and you're really gone.
I wasn't prepared for how being without you would be.

It's hard to move on,while clinging to the past.
But I know without you, I lost me.
Without you, I lost my identity.

It's hard to say hate you,
For what you've done to me, it was wrong.
You left with no sign,not one little clue.
When you left you never looked back,
Leaving me with nothing but a memory.

It's hard to think of you,
And not feel so sad.
Thinking brought you here, staring down at me,
Shaking with emotion, saying you left the best thing you've ever had.

It's hard not to hurt you just the same,
For who was the one to really blame?
It's hard to let you close again,
But seeing you here and now,
I have to keep you as close as I can.
It's hard to live again without you,
I hope you love as much as I do.
